2011-10-18 43 views
0

我有,我想在文本中找到的單詞列表。我想用鏈接替換這些單詞與其對應的頁面。這將用於作者,一些詞彙詞或參考。PHP:在一個詞彙查找文字,並添加一個鏈接到它

任何想法如何實現?有沒有這樣的開源軟件包?

謝謝。

+0

您希望用鏈接替換每個出現的單詞/ s,並且它們是鏈接中遵循的任何特定模式。 – punit

回答

0

難道我明白你的想法?

<?php 

str_replace('Romeo and Juliet', '<a href="http://shakespeare.mit.edu/romeo_juliet/">Romeo and Juliet</a>'); 

?> 
+0

是和否。我有一個需要與不同文本匹配的單詞列表,這個單詞列表可能會增長或縮小。但我不想爲列表中的每個單詞添加一行str_replace。最終的結果將是取代羅密歐和朱麗葉的一個類似於你提供的鏈接。 – Onema

+0

你不應該添加它的每一行,請再具體些,我真的不能明白什麼具體你需要 – user973254

+0

對不起,我不清楚的問題和解釋。這是我想要做的。 $ content = preg_replace(array($ pattern1,$ pattern2,$ pattern3),'',$ content); 但如果有實際匹配的自定義詞彙表內容有任何PHP包我不知道。有些網站會突出顯示多個單詞(例如計算機),並且當您翻閱計算機服務時彈出窗口。他們沒有手動輸入,而是在幕後替換了一些單詞,並基於他們添加了一個自定義鏈接或JS – Onema

相關問題